When you travel to the island of keish, there are a couple of mus of the look. Were going to show you few of them, starting with this traditional twin water reservoir. Back in the old days in islands such as this that are surrounded with salt water, drinkable water was very scarce and they needed to preserve it, so they built structures like this. As you can see, it has five wind towers and what they did was they directed the wind inside the domes and kept the water cool and fresh. The original reservoir crumpled years ago and in 1993 to collect rainwater. And to make use the subterranean waters, they rebuilt it in the image of the historic reservoirs of yaz. People access the water using a passage called pashiir, the direction of which was changed during the reconstruction so that visitors could easily get to these cylindrical pools using steps. This traditional Twin Reservoir is right next to the ancient city of harire. And was a part of it. If youre interested in the history of iranian islands, then paying visit to this ancient city on kish is must. The ruins of harire extend for about three square kilometers along the northern coastline and whisper the existence of very large and cultivated city. The ancient city of harire was established during the seljuk era about 800 years ago. The people who lived here were mostly pearl merchants, fishermen and tradesmen who. Digging began in 1992 and to this day harira has experienced five seasons of excavations. Very few buildings have been on earth in the ancient city of harira and the palatian house, the one were in right now, is one of them, twostory house that apparently belong to a welloff merchant. Some of the most. Important findings have been excavated in this area and theyve helped estimate the age of this ancient city. Some of these findings are on display at the hyrim. Museum and include section of eightpointed tile decorated with pieces of oyster shells, capital heads in the sasanian architectural style and more. In addition to the pallation house, bath house, mosk and the remains of a trading port have been on earth. اینجا درخوانان مغول یکی از مهم ترین. 5 meters off the coast. Merchants had access to boats that could go under the rocky cliff side and load and unload merchandise through these vertical stairways. This architectural form has not been seen in any other part of the Southern Coast of iran. It seems that in 1507, little after the portuguese captured the island of hormos, the ancient city of harira was abandoned. The remnance of said event on the island is a single cannon. You see, in fac carries means aquedoct. The visitors area of the curries was constructed by mansur haj hoseini in 1989. 15 کیلومتر طول قنات جزیره کیش هست که در این 15 کیلومتر. Below the surface so the wells are actually top of you. Recently the entrance of one of the wells was widened so we can see the different layers of the ground. The first seven meters consists of fossilized coral stones that have been. Formed after tens of millions of years and are tough enough to support this structure without the use of pillars. Two meters below that you have the green m which is perfect for filtering salt water and in between you have mixture of the two. All along the path and especially near the end where you have the museum, in addition to the tools used in its reconstruction, you can see various historical items on display that give you a glimpse of the earth and wear and tools used. In those days and just before you reach the end, you get to the payab, that means by the foot of the water. This is the path people use to get water. Mostly women carrying clay pitches would walk down these stairs, walk up to the water, fill their pitches and go back home. They would do this several times to have sufficient amount of drinkable water throughout the day. Everything aside, i think the most interesting thing of all is that according to the document. Findings the actual aqueadoct was originally carved out of the tough coral stones using hatchets, hammers and axes after years and years of hard labor, simply to preserve the natural Water Resources of the island.
